Internal Auditor

Summary Job Summary The Internal Auditor is responsible for planning, conducting and overseeing internal audits to evaluate the effectiveness of the hospital’s internal controls, policies and procedures. Ensures compliance with applicable laws and regulations, identifies opportunities for operational improvement, and supports the organization’s mission through objective, independent, and ethical audit practices. Works closely with hospital leadership, department management staff, Fiscal Services, and the Compliance Committee to maintain strong organizational accountability and integrity. IV. Minimum Job Requirements: Work Experience: Five years of experience in special audits, fraud detection, and financial auditing are required, preferably within a healthcare or hospital setting. A strong understanding of hospital operations, compliance regulations (e.g., HIPAA, Medicare, Medicaid), and healthcare accounting practice. Experience in risk assessment, internal controls, audit software, and data analysis tools is essential, along with the ability to prepare clear, comprehensive audit reports and collaborate with external auditors. License/Registration/Certification: Certified Public Accountant (CPA) preferred. Education and Training: Bachelor's degree in Accounting, Finance, Business Administration or related field required. Master’s degree in Business Administration (MBA) or Master’s in Accounting, Finance or related field preferred. Skills: Knowledge of GAAP and GAAS. Understanding of accounting and auditing standards, including internal control frameworks (e.g., COSO) and professional auditing standards set by the Institute of Internal Auditors (IIA). Familiarity with applicable federal, state, and healthcare regulations, as well as hospital compliance requirements. Ability in audit practices, risk assessment, internal control evaluation, and hospital operations, both clinical and non-clinical. Knowledge in developing, implementing, and monitoring audit policies and procedures. Ability in using ERP, EHR, and other relevant audit tools for data analysis and operational auditing. Knowledge of fraud detection methods and investigative techniques, ensuring organizational integrity. Ability to interpret complex financial data and identify deficiencies, risks, and performance gaps. Strong skills in writing clear, objective audit reports and presenting findings to management and compliance committees. Ability to work with department directors/managers, Fiscal Services, and external auditors to solve control weaknesses and improve processes. Commitment to supporting confidentiality and upholding ethical standards in all audit activities. Strong planning, organizational, and time management skills to manage multiple audits and meet deadlines. Ability to exercise independent judgment, remain impartial, and adapt to emerging risks while maintaining integrity and professionalism.

Real Estate Paralegal

AmLaw100 firm seeking experienced real estate paralegal. Exciting career opportunity with excellent benefits, compensation, and career development opportunities. This Jobot Job is hosted by: Ken Clarke Are you a fit? Easy Apply now by clicking the "Apply Now" button and sending us your resume. Salary: $80,000 - $100,000 per year A bit about us: Our client has an immediate opening for an experienced Real Estate Paralegal to join their team in their New York City office. This is a strong career opportunity with an excellent platform at an AmLaw 00 firm offering exposure to sophisticated real estate transactions including acquisitions, dispositions, financings, and debt and equity deals across multiple markets. Interested candidates should have 5 years of real estate paralegal experience with strong knowledge of due diligence processes, title and survey review, closing coordination, and real estate conveyance documents. The incoming paralegal will play a key role in supporting complex real estate transactions from due diligence through closing, managing multiple projects simultaneously, and providing exceptional service to both internal and external clients. Core responsibilities include performing and coordinating due diligence (title commitments, surveys, zoning reports), preparing title and survey objection letters, assisting in preparation and review of real estate conveyance and closing documents, coordinating closings for acquisitions, dispositions and financings, preparing closing books, drafting and filing UCC financing statements, drafting leases, purchase contracts, easements and deeds, and interfacing with firm clients and outside entities on assigned matters.
